首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ql进程怎么杀死进程

要杀死MySQL进程,你可以使用以下几种方法:

方法一:使用SHOW PROCESSLISTKILL命令

  1. 查看所有MySQL进程
  2. 查看所有MySQL进程
  3. 这个命令会列出当前所有的MySQL连接及其对应的进程ID(PID)。
  4. 杀死指定进程: 假设你要杀死的进程ID是1234,你可以使用以下命令:
  5. 杀死指定进程: 假设你要杀死的进程ID是1234,你可以使用以下命令:

方法二:使用系统命令

如果你知道MySQL进程的系统进程ID(PID),你可以直接使用系统命令来杀死它。假设你的MySQL进程ID是5678,你可以使用以下命令:

  • 在Linux系统中:
  • 在Linux系统中:
  • 在Windows系统中:
  • 在Windows系统中:

方法三:使用pkill命令(Linux系统)

如果你不确定具体的进程ID,但知道进程名,可以使用pkill命令来杀死所有匹配的进程。例如,要杀死所有MySQL进程,可以使用以下命令:

代码语言:txt
复制
sudo pkill -f mysql

注意事项

  1. 谨慎操作:杀死MySQL进程可能会导致数据不一致或损坏,因此在执行这些操作之前,请确保你已经备份了重要数据。
  2. 权限:杀死MySQL进程通常需要管理员权限,因此请确保你有足够的权限来执行这些操作。
  3. 重启MySQL服务:如果你杀死了MySQL的主进程,可能需要手动重启MySQL服务才能恢复数据库的正常运行。

示例代码

以下是一个简单的示例,展示如何在Linux系统中使用SHOW PROCESSLISTKILL命令来杀死MySQL进程:

代码语言:txt
复制
# 连接到MySQL服务器
mysql -u username -p

# 查看所有进程
SHOW PROCESSLIST;

# 假设要杀死的进程ID是1234
KILL 1234;

参考链接

希望这些信息对你有所帮助!如果你有其他问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券